Kilim attributed to Boncza fl. ca. 1920–1930. Woven decorative fabric, 1920s, from Tomczyce, Poland. In the main field symmetrically arranged floral-branch motifs: four around the center and four in the corners. Wide border decorated with arranged floral branches and two rows of single leaves. Colors: background brown; ornament in yellow, straw, and green. Height 207 cm, width 150 cm., A woven textile with a dark brown background showing a pattern of leaf-like shapes in shades of green, yellowish-beige, and pale pink, a frayed fabric edge with loose beige threads along one side, a narrow wooden rod with a strip of royal blue fabric attached at the top left, and a small dark gray clip securing the textile at the top.
